Are UKGC licensed casinos better for free spins?

Strictly speaking, yes. The UK Gambling Commission forces operators to be clearer about terms. You will not see ‘unlimited free spins’ nonsense. The wagering is stated upfront. The downside? The offers are less flashy. You will not see a £500 bonus with 10 free spins. It is more controlled. But for safety, I prefer a UKGC license. Bet365 and Unibet are solid examples.

What is the best way to use free spins on a small budget?

Target slots with high RTP and low volatility. Games like Blood Suckers (98% RTP) or Jack Hammer (97% RTP) are good. Do not chase the progressive jackpots with free spins. The wagering requirements will kill you. Also, check the ‘max bet’ rule. Some sites say you cannot bet more than £5 per spin while wagering a bonus. Stick to 10p or 20p spins to stretch the play.

The Hidden Clauses Nobody Talks About

I read the terms and conditions for five different operators. It is painful. But I found a few traps. One common clause is the ‘game weighting’ rule. Free spins are often restricted to a single game. That is fine. But the wagering requirements on the winnings? Some sites only count certain slots at 100%. Others count at 50% or even 10%. If you win £10 from free spins, and the wagering is 35x, you need to bet £350. If only 50% of your bets count, you actually need to bet £700. That is a killer.

Another clause: ‘max bet while wagering’. I saw a site that said you cannot bet more than £2.50 per spin while clearing a bonus. If you are a penny slot player, that is fine. But if you try to speed through the wagering with bigger bets, you void the bonus. Always check that.

And the expiry dates. Some free spins expire in 24 hours. Others in 7 days. The winnings from those spins often expire in 72 hours. Do not sit on them. Use them immediately.

Responsible Gambling and UK Laws

I have to mention this. The UKGC is strict. All the sites I mentioned are licensed. That means they have to offer deposit limits, time-outs, and self-exclusion tools. Use them. Free spins are a marketing tool. They are not a guaranteed win. I have seen players chase losses with bonus money. It never ends well.

Set a budget. Stick to it. If you deposit £10 and lose it, walk away. Do not chase the free spins. They are a bonus, not a lifeline.
